迅睿CMS框架是一款PHP8高性能·简单易用的CMS开源开发框架,基于MIT开源许可协议发布,免费且不限制商业使用,是免费开源的产品,以万端互联为设计理念,支持的微信公众号、小程序、APP客户端、移动端网站、PC网站等多终端式管理系统。
联系官方销售客服
1835022288
028-61286886
list.html列表循环中,
使用
<?php $t.字段名=dr_string2array($t.字段名);echo implode('-', $t.字段名)?>
输入的是 value值,如何输出中文的name值呢?
简约|1 中式|2
{php $field = dr_field_options_id(字段id号码);} <?php $ts=dr_string2array($t.字段名);?> {loop $ts $bb} 选项名称:{$field[$bb]} 选项值:{$bb} {/loop}
把红的全部不要,这样就可以直接读取文字,name和value就一样了这样和你加value1-9效果一样,不利于查询的写法最高效的写法是前面中文,后面数字,然后存储类型改成int数字型,再然后把这个字段创建索引关系,这样才能达到搜索高效
那这种调用方式就不一样了